Mt. Joy is an American indie rock band that has earned a devoted following with their blend of rock, indie folk, and psychedelic-inspired sounds, combining catchy melodies with introspective lyrics. The five-piece group consists of Matt Quinn (vocals, guitar), Sam Cooper (guitar), Sotiris Eliopoulos (drums), Jackie Miclau (keyboards), and Michael Byrnes (bass). Quinn and Cooper first connected in high school in Philadelphia, later reuniting in Los Angeles in 2016 to form Mt. Joy, inspired by a nearby mountain in their hometown of Valley Forge, PA. They met Byrnes through Craigslist, who introduced them to producer Caleb Nelson, and together they recorded four tracks under the Mt. Joy name, including their breakout single “Astrovan,” which surpassed three million streams and convinced the band to pursue music full-time. In 2017, singles like “Sheep,” “Cardinal,” and “Silver Lining” further established their reputation, leading to a deal with Dualtone Records and their self-titled debut album in 2018. The band quickly became a festival favorite, performing with The Lumineers and touring extensively until the pandemic. Subsequent releases, including Rearrange Us (2020), Orange Blood (2022), and live albums Live at Red Rocks and Live at The Salt Shed, showcased their evolving sound and dynamic performances. Their popular tracks such as “Ruins,” “Roly Poly,” and “Evergreen” highlighted their lyrical depth and musical versatility, while 2024’s single “Highway Queen” reaffirmed their emotional resonance. From festival stages to intimate venues, Mt. Joy continues to captivate audiences, blending heartfelt songwriting with expansive, immersive performances, securing their place as one of the most compelling and evolving indie rock acts of their generation.
